数据库loap是什么意思
-
数据库LOAP是指"Large Object Application Protocol",也称为"大对象应用协议"。LOAP是一种用于管理和存储大型对象的协议,大型对象通常是指数据量较大的文件、图像、音频或视频等。
以下是关于数据库LOAP的几个要点:
-
存储大型对象:LOAP允许将大型对象存储在数据库中,而不是将其存储在文件系统中。这样可以方便地将大型对象与其他数据一起管理,并使用数据库的事务和查询功能进行操作。
-
数据传输协议:LOAP定义了一种用于传输大型对象的协议。它可以通过网络将大型对象从客户端传输到服务器端,并在数据库中进行存储。
-
分段存储:LOAP将大型对象分成多个段进行存储。每个段都有唯一的标识符,并且可以单独访问和操作。这样可以提高存储效率,并允许对大型对象的部分进行修改或访问。
-
数据压缩和加密:LOAP支持对大型对象进行压缩和加密。压缩可以减少存储空间的占用,而加密可以保护数据的安全性。
-
多种数据类型支持:LOAP支持多种数据类型的大型对象,包括文本、图像、音频、视频等。这使得LOAP可以广泛应用于各种应用场景,如多媒体存储、文档管理等。
总而言之,数据库LOAP是一种用于管理和存储大型对象的协议。它提供了方便的数据传输、分段存储、数据压缩和加密等功能,适用于各种应用场景。
1年前 -
-
数据库LOAP是指"Local Open Access Publishing",即本地开放获取出版物。LOAP是一种开放获取的出版模式,旨在促进学术研究成果的自由获取和传播。
LOAP的目标是将学术研究成果免费提供给全球读者,以便任何人都可以免费阅读和使用这些成果。与传统的出版模式不同,LOAP不依赖于订阅费用或购买出版物的方式,而是通过作者支付出版费用来资助出版过程。
在LOAP模式中,作者通常需要支付一定的出版费用,这些费用将用于支持出版物的编辑、排版、印刷和在线发布等过程。一旦出版物发布,它就会立即成为开放获取,任何人都可以免费阅读和下载。
LOAP模式的优势在于它提供了更广泛的读者群体和更快的传播速度。由于出版物是免费的,读者无需支付任何费用就可以访问和使用研究成果。这有助于促进知识的共享和学术研究的进展。
此外,LOAP模式还促进了学术研究成果的可见性和引用率。由于出版物是开放获取的,它们更容易被搜索引擎索引,并且更容易被其他研究人员引用。这有助于提高作者的学术声誉和研究成果的影响力。
总而言之,数据库LOAP是一种开放获取的出版模式,旨在促进学术研究成果的自由获取和传播。它通过作者支付出版费用来资助出版过程,并提供免费的阅读和下载服务。LOAP模式具有促进知识共享、加速传播速度和提高学术影响力的优势。
1年前 -
数据库LOAP是什么意思?
LOAP(Log-Structured Object Addressing and Persistence)是一种数据库存储和持久化的架构。它是一种基于日志结构的存储方式,用于处理大规模的数据存储和高性能的数据读写操作。
LOAP的设计目标是提供快速的随机读写操作、高度可扩展性和持久化数据的一致性。它将数据存储在日志(log)中,而不是传统的块或页结构。这种日志结构的方式可以提供更高的写入性能,因为数据可以追加到日志的末尾,而不需要更新已有的数据块。
下面将详细介绍LOAP的方法和操作流程。
一、LOAP的方法
-
日志结构存储:LOAP使用日志结构存储(Log-Structured Storage)的方式来管理数据。它将数据写入日志(log)的末尾,并且永远不会更新已经写入的数据。当需要读取数据时,LOAP会根据索引查找对应的日志记录,并将其返回。
-
分层索引:为了提高查询性能,LOAP使用了分层索引(Hierarchical Indexing)的方法。它将索引分为多个层级,每个层级都包含一部分索引项。较低层级的索引项指向较高层级的索引项,最终指向实际的数据位置。这种分层的索引结构可以减少索引的大小,提高查询性能。
-
写前日志(Write-Ahead Logging):为了保证数据的一致性和持久性,LOAP使用了写前日志的方式。在写入数据之前,它会先将数据写入日志,然后再将数据写入实际的数据位置。这样可以确保即使在发生系统崩溃等异常情况时,数据也可以通过日志进行恢复。
二、LOAP的操作流程
-
数据写入:当需要写入数据时,LOAP会将数据追加到日志的末尾,并生成对应的索引项。同时,它会将数据写入实际的数据位置,并更新索引项的指针。写入操作是原子性的,即要么全部成功,要么全部失败。
-
数据查询:当需要查询数据时,LOAP会根据查询条件在索引中查找对应的索引项。然后,它会根据索引项的指针找到实际的数据位置,并将数据返回给用户。查询操作可以并行进行,因为索引和数据是分离存储的。
-
数据更新:由于LOAP采用了日志结构存储的方式,所以更新操作实际上是写入操作的一种特殊情况。当需要更新数据时,LOAP会先将更新的数据追加到日志的末尾,然后生成对应的索引项。同时,它会将更新的数据写入实际的数据位置,并更新索引项的指针。
-
数据删除:当需要删除数据时,LOAP并不会立即从日志中删除对应的记录。而是将删除操作标记为无效,并保留在日志中。这是为了保证数据的一致性和持久性。当需要释放存储空间时,LOAP会进行日志的压缩和合并操作,将无效的记录删除,并释放相应的存储空间。
总结:
数据库LOAP采用了日志结构存储和分层索引的方法,可以提供快速的随机读写操作、高度可扩展性和持久化数据的一致性。它将数据存储在日志中,并使用分层索引进行查询。同时,LOAP还使用写前日志来保证数据的一致性和持久性。通过以上的方法和操作流程,LOAP可以有效地处理大规模的数据存储和高性能的数据读写操作。
1年前 -